Mcmaster-Carr has the o rings in bags of 50 for around $7 plus shipping.
Don`t know if you ever replaced them or not, but put all 4 together as an assembly. Grease up the rings,
slip the first one on, and then roll the 2nd on over the first so there isn`t the possibility of it getting nicked
or cut trying to work it past the first groove on the injector.
Dash# 111
Width 3/32
ID 7/16
OD 5/8
part# 9464K24
I buy the rubber hose at NAPA about 6ft of it, think it is 4mm? Dang stuff will want to have a curve to it, so
alternate each piece and your assy will be in a straight line. Works w/o any leaks.
